Objective: To offer support to those in need outside the
parish, in response to Christ's command and as an expression of
God's love.
Your contributions to the Outreach Ministry provide immediate and
ongoing support for charitable needs in Los Alamos and elsewhere.
We provide direct donations of money, food and household items,
and coordinate various parish outreach activities. Through this
ministry TOTH has a significant impact worldwide for improving people's
lives and helping them in times of trouble. Our bulletin board near
the Church office shows some of the many charities that we support.
Outreach Budget
Outreach's initial 2004 budget was $11,174 but, along with other
ministry budgets, was reduced in June by the Vestry, to $10,446.
In addition to this, we had $519 from 2003 (a voided check and a
misclassified gift). We adjusted our plan to expend the budget approximately
equally among local, regional, national, and international needs
due to unprecedented hurricane disasters in Florida and humanitarian
response to terrorism in Russia. Major distributions from the Outreach
budget (see also non-budget funds) are listed below. Outreach has
been allocated $10,000 for its 2005 budget.
Activities:
- Distribute parish Outreach funds to appropriate charities and
individuals outside the parish internationally, nationally, regionally
and locally.
- Respond to emergencies, locally and beyond.
- Keep the congregation informed about need and projects of the
Ministry so that all parishioners, including children, will have
an opportunity to serve.
- Oversee Thanksgiving and Christmas basket offering project,
Adopt-a-Family project, United Thank Offerings and Episcopal Renewal
and Development offerings, and any other such projects in which
the Ministry chooses to participate.
- Coordinate ecumenical activities with other local churches and
agencies, such as Interfaith Recovery Network and Self help.
